西北工业大学计算机学院考研机试题集梳理

需积分: 20 9 下载量 146 浏览量 更新于2024-07-20 2 收藏 861KB PDF 举报
西北工业大学计算机学院的考研机试题库包含了一系列针对计算机科学基础和算法设计的题目,旨在考察考生对数据结构、算法理解以及编程技能。以下是一些关键知识点的详细解析: 1. **字符串处理**:第1101题至1105题涵盖了字符串操作,如SurprisingString(可能是指字符串的惊奇特性)、CalfFlac(可能是某个特定算法或编程任务),以及字符统计、复制字符串和大小比较,这些都是计算机科学中常见的字符串处理任务。 2. **数据结构基础**:1106~1115题涉及到链表的创建(1116-1119)与操作,如插入、删除等,这体现了对线性数据结构的理解。1120题的字符统计是另一个基础数据结构的应用,而猴子挖花生、简单鞍点等题目可能涉及更高级的数据结构或搜索算法。 3. **算法设计**:1121~1129题包含了字符串替换、猴子问题(可能是动态规划)、寻找鞍点(可能是查找局部最优解)、字符统计(重复出现频率)、机器人路径问题、合并有序数组等,这些都是典型算法设计实例。 4. **数学和逻辑**:1130~1145题包括了假身份证验证、回文质数判断、数学谜题如百钱百鸡问题、亲密数和阿姆斯特朗数等,测试了考生的数学思维和逻辑推理能力。 5. **数学游戏和智力题**:1146~1153题涵盖了找倍数、迷宫问题、字母转换、农场灌溉等,这些题目往往结合数学原理,挑战考生解决问题的能力。 6. **数值计算和分析**:1154题提到的小学奥数可能涉及基础数学运算,1157题泰勒展开式则涉及微积分中的数学工具。1158题公路限速可能需要考虑速度计算和规则应用。 7. **逻辑与策略**:1159~1163题涵盖了N皇后问题、六数码问题(可能是解决二维空间的逻辑布局问题)等经典逻辑谜题,以及计算最小余留数和最大连续序列和等。 8. **组合与排列**:1164~1169题涉及了排列组合的理论,如排列问题、24点游戏和字符串匹配,这些都是算法设计和逻辑分析的重要组成部分。 这个试题库覆盖了计算机科学的基础知识、算法设计、数学应用和逻辑思维等多个方面,对于备考西北工业大学计算机学院的研究生入学考试具有很高的参考价值。考生在做题过程中不仅能巩固理论知识,还能提升实际编程能力。